What is Compass Academy?
Compass Academy is an educational institution focused on enabling students to realize their unique talents while mastering core academic skills. The academy emphasizes the development of social-emotional strengths and learner competencies essential for the modern era. By deploying a team of diverse AmeriCorps members and leveraging advances in learning sciences, Compass Academy aims to create a personalized learning environment. The institution previously received a notable $2.5 million grant from the XQ Institute's Super School Project, an initiative backed by Laurene Powell Jobs, aimed at rethinking the American high school model.
How much funding has Compass Academy raised?
Compass Academy has raised a total of $857K across 2 funding rounds:

Debt (2020): $350K with participation from PPP
Debt (2021): $507K led by PPP
